Poor self-esteem

In recent years, the link between ADHD and low self-esteem has been investigated in greater detail. Both genders are vulnerable to this disorder. Early treatment can help keep it from developing into an even more severe personality disorder.

Research has found that ADHD young people are at a higher risk of developing addiction disorders. They are more likely to drink, smoke and take part in other drugs during their adolescent and adult adhd symptoms quiz years. These issues are associated with the inability to pay attention and an impulsive nature. These symptoms can be alleviated with effective interventions and improved quality of life.

ADHD females may have trouble maintaining their social skills as well as interpersonal relationships and sexual performance. This can prevent them from accessing peer support, and may also increase the risk of being sexually exploited.

Females suffering from ADHD are at greater risk than adolescents to develop an addiction to drugs. Substance abuse is often utilized to alleviate feelings of inadequacy. The symptoms of this comorbidity may include irritability, moodiness anxiety, and poor sleep.

Psychoeducation, CBT, medication and medication can all be used to treat ADHD and low self-esteem. These interventions can improve executive performance and time management, as well as planning and executive functioning. Strategies to reduce anxiety and impulsivity can help lower the risk of developing substance abuse disorders.

A thorough assessment of ADHD should include symptoms that are both functional and symptom like across a variety of settings, including occupational, social, and educational environments. Other neuropsychological tests can help in the assessment.

Changes in the physiology and sexual maturation

Women who suffer from ADHD are at greater danger of being sexually abused. They are also more likely to self-harm. They often have problems with their interpersonal relationships. This can limit their ability to access peer support and a safe social network.

Girls who suffer from ADHD are more sexually active than peers at a younger age. It is not unusual to find ADHD females to become mothers in their teens. These mothers could be forced to manage multiple responsibilities.

Females suffering from ADHD have more trouble maintaining friendships than men with adhd symptoms with the condition. This can cause depression and loneliness. There is also a higher risk of suicide among women suffering from the disorder. The stigma associated with sexual risky behavior can make relationships more difficult.

Girls who are sexually active and suffer from ADHD might be more likely to experience a difficult time resolving conflicts with others. They might feel rejected and react with bravado. The bravado doesn't solve anxiety. In addition, they could turn to drugs or alcohol to deal with the stress.

The treatment recommended for ADHD is the same for both boys and girls there are some distinctions in how they are provided. Treatments for females need to be administered in a sensitive way. If eating disorders are a problem the use of stimulant medication should be taken into consideration.

Women suffering from ADHD typically have low self-esteem that can make them more vulnerable to physical or emotional abuse. Because of this, they might be less likely to seek help. Additionally confidence issues can cause them to conceal their feelings and despair from others.
